Transaction 667d3425919a17613412bef1c48651eff16266e3579cd4798a799d49ff01f41a

1 Input
2 Outputs
  • 667d3425919a17613412bef1c48651eff16266e3579cd4798a799d49ff01f41a:0
  • value  7081663
    address  32DQ4Nu24yrkZXTqDJJYudAUuyv3aqZayg
  • 667d3425919a17613412bef1c48651eff16266e3579cd4798a799d49ff01f41a:1
  • value  70512791
    address  3C8pwUtw75WZwuacvnK3dHqgYK1yn4uEt1